Discover Find It…

You might have noticed that the Library has a new search tool called Find It… where you can search not only physical items located in the library (such as books, DVDs and audiobooks), but you can search for scholarly articles in our subscription databases as well…in one place. ONE. PLACE.

While Find It replaces our online catalog and indexes most of our subscription databases, you can still search a specific database by visiting our A-Z Database page. However, I think you will find that Find It will be more than sufficient for your research, and easier to use.

It defaults to an “everything” search, but you can select to search only Tech Collections (to see items the library owns) or Articles (to search in our subscription databases). Once you have searched you can then use the left side of the page to refine your results by type, location, date, and more.

You can also sign in to “My Account” and see what you have checked out, renew your items, or make a list of saved items from a search to view later.
